آموزشآموزش سخت‌ افزار

پردازنده (CPU) چیه و چه کاری انجام میده؟

پردازنده یا همون CPU، مهم‌ترین قطعه در هر سیستم کامپیوتریه که بدون اون هیچ چیزی توی دستگاه شما کار نمی‌کنه. پردازنده مثل مغز یه آدمه که تصمیم می‌گیره و دستور می‌ده همه چیز چطور پیش بره. حالا تو این مطلب می‌خوایم ببینیم پردازنده دقیقاً چیه، چی کار می‌کنه، چی باعث میشه که پردازنده‌ها فرق داشته باشن و چطور شرکت‌ها پردازنده‌ها رو می‌سازن. تا پایان این مطلب همراه بنچفا باشید.

پردازنده (CPU) چیه؟

پردازنده یا همون CPU، مرکزی‌ترین قسمت سیستم کامپیوتریه که کارش انجام دادن تمام پردازش‌ها و محاسباته. وقتی شما یه برنامه باز می‌کنید یا می‌خواید یه کاری با کامپیوتر یا گوشی انجام بدید، پردازنده دستورات رو اجرا می‌کنه و نتیجه رو به شما نشون می‌ده.

اینتل موجودی کافی برای گارانتی خرابی پردازنده‌های نسل 13 و 14 رو نداره!

خیلی ساده بخوایم بگیم، پردازنده یه سری عملیات انجام میده مثل جمع و تفریق، مقایسه اعداد، یا حتی انتقال اطلاعات بین قسمت‌های مختلف سیستم. این کارها به کمک میلیون‌ها ترانزیستور توی پردازنده انجام می‌شه. در نهایت پردازنده این اطلاعات رو برای نمایش به پردازنده گرافیکی انتقال میده.

وظایف پردازنده (CPU) در سیستم

پردازنده کارهای مختلفی انجام می‌ده، اما به طور کلی میشه گفت سه تا کار اصلی داره:

  1. دریافت دستورها: اول از همه پردازنده دستوراتی که از برنامه‌ها و نرم‌افزارها بهش داده شده رو دریافت می‌کنه.
  2. انجام محاسبات و پردازش: بعد پردازنده این دستورات رو پردازش می‌کنه. مثلاً ممکنه یه محاسبه ریاضی انجام بده یا داده‌ای رو جابه‌جا کنه.
  3. ارسال نتیجه: در آخر، پردازنده نتیجه کارش رو به بقیه اجزای سیستم می‌فرسته تا نتیجه به کار بیاد.

این سه مرحله در هر ثانیه ممکنه میلیون‌ها بار تکرار بشه. به همین خاطره که پردازنده‌ها باید قدرت زیادی داشته باشن تا بتونن این همه کار رو سریع انجام بدن. هرچقدر سریع‌تر و با مصرف برق کمتر، بهتر.

انواع معماری پردازنده یا سی‌پی‌یو

پردازنده‌ یا همون سی‌پی‌یوها انواع مختلفی دارن که معروف‌ترینشون معماری x86 و ARM هستن. این معماری‌ها تفاوت‌هایی دارن که باعث میشه پردازنده‌ها سرعت، مصرف انرژی، و کارایی‌های مختلفی داشته باشن.

معماری x86

معماری x86 بیشتر توی کامپیوترهای شخصی (PC) و لپ‌تاپ‌ها استفاده میشه. این معماری از قدیمی‌ترین معماری‌هاست که توسط اینتل توسعه داده شد و در طی سال‌ها اینتل و AMD اون رو بهینه کردن. پردازنده‌های x86 برای بالاترین میزان عملکرد بهینه شدن و معمولاً انرژی زیادی مصرف می‌کنن و گرمای زیادی تولید می‌کنن. امتیاز تولید پردازنده بر پایه این معماری رو فقط اینتل و AMD دارن.

معماری ARM

معماری ARM کاملاً از x86 متفاوته. هر شرکتی که از هولدینگ آرم گواهی بگیره، می‌تونه بر پایه معماری اون‌ها پردازنده بسازه. این معماری برای بهینگی عملکرد نسبت به مصرف برق توسعه داده شده و بیشتر توسط دستگاه‌های پرتابل استفاده میشه. کوالکام پردازنده‌های مبتنی بر ARM رو برای موبایل‌ها و لپ‌تاپ می‌سازه و اپل هم بر پایه این معماری تمام پردازنده‌هاش رو تولید می‌کنه.

شرکت‌های تولیدکننده پردازنده

چند تا از بزرگ‌ترین شرکت‌هایی که پردازنده تولید می‌کنن عبارتند از:

  1. Intel: این شرکت یکی از بزرگ‌ترین تولیدکنندگان پردازنده‌های x86 توی دنیاست و پردازنده‌های معروف سری Core و Xeon رو تولید می‌کنه. پردازنده‌های این شرکت در پیسی‌های دسکتاپ، لپ‌تاپ و سرورها دیده میشه و قبلا هم پردازنده‌های مک‌های اپل رو می‌ساخت.
  2. AMD: رقیب اصلی Intel، پردازنده‌های سری Ryzen و EPYC رو می‌سازه که توی بخش‌های مختلف بازار از جمله بازی‌ها و سرورها خیلی محبوب شدن. سری رایزن رو ما در دسکتاپ، لپ‌تاپ و همچنین کنسول‌های بازی خانگی و پرتابل می‌بینیم. سری EPYC سری مناسب سرور این شرکته.
  3. Qualcomm: این شرکت پردازنده‌های Snapdragon رو می‌سازه که بیشتر توی گوشی‌های موبایل استفاده میشه و بر اساس معماری ARM هستن. کوالکام به تازگی پردازنده Snapdragon X Elite و X Plus رو برای لپ‌تاپ‌ها عرضه کرده که روی Vivobook S15 دیدیم.
  4. Apple: اپل خودش پردازنده‌هایی مثل A-series برای گوشی‌های آیفون و M-series برای مک‌ها رو طراحی کرده که بر پایه معماری ARM هستن. جدیدترین نسخه این پردازنده‌ها، سری A18 برای آیفون ۱۶ و سری M4 برای مک بوک، آیپد و مک‌های دسکتاپ این شرکته.

جمع بندی

پردازنده‌ها به‌عنوان قلب تپنده هر سیستم کامپیوتری عمل می‌کنن و بدون وجودشون هیچ‌چیز کار نمی‌کنه. هر چی پردازنده قوی‌تر باشه، سیستم شما سریع‌تر و کارآمدتر میشه. معماری‌های مختلف مثل x86 و ARM هم ویژگی‌های خاص خودشون رو دارن که باعث میشه پردازنده‌ها توی کاربردهای مختلف بهتر عمل کنن. شرکت‌های بزرگی مثل Intel، AMD، Qualcomm و Apple هم هر کدوم پردازنده‌هایی با ویژگی‌های متفاوت تولید می‌کنن که توی دستگاه‌های مختلف استفاده میشه.

امیدوارم این توضیحات به شما کمک کرده باشه تا بدونید پردازنده چیه و بیشتر با پردازنده‌ها و تفاوت‌های معماری‌ها آشنا بشید!

این پست براتون مفید بود؟ خوشحال می‌شیم نظرتون رو بدونیم!

روی ستاره‌ها بزنید تا به این مطلب امتیاز بدید!

میانگین امتیاز این مطلب ۰ / ۵. تعداد امتیازات ۰

نظری برای این مطلب ثبت نشده! شما اولین نفری هستید که رای می‌دید!

محسن خدابخش

.Hello there من محسنم، با کلی علاقه که هیچ ربطی به هم ندارن. علاقه‌ام به گیم از 5 سالگی شروع شد و بیشتر فهمیدن درباره اینکه چطوری بازی‌ها اجرا میشن باعث شد به دنیای سخت افزار کامپیوتر وارد بشم. عاشق فیلم و سریال (مخصوصا استار وارز) هستم و تا الان زمان زیادی از زندگیم رو پای League of Legends هدر دادم.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

نوشته‌های مشابه

دکمه بازگشت به بالا